The Sri Lankan Squad comprising of 15 players for the 5-ODI Series against South Africa was announced today. The Lankan squad includes the name of medium pacer Nuwan Kulasekara who makes an international comeback after four month due to an injury which he sustained during the home series against Australia.
Also in the ODI Squad is left-arm spinner Rangana Herath who played the key role in Sri Lanka’s maiden Test win in South Africa at Durban. Off spinner Suraj Randiv, Jeevan Mendis and Seekkuge Prasanna who were part of the One Day Squad against Pakistan have been axed.
Here is the Sri Lanka ODI Squad for the 5-match Series against South Africa :
1. Tillakaratne Dilshan (Captain)
2. Angelo Mathews (Vice-Captain)
3. Upul Tharanga
4. Kumar Sangakkara (Wicket Keeper)
5. Mahela Jayawardena
6. Dinesh Chandimal
7. Kosala Kulesekera
8. Thisara Perera
9. Lasith Malinga
10. Nuwan Kulasekera
11. Ajantha Mendis
12. Rangana Herath
13. Dhammika Prasad
14. Dilhara Fernando
15. Lahiru Thirimanne
